severe bun = 紧绷的发髻
- The strict librarian always wore her hair in a severe bun.那位严格的图书管理员总是把头发梳成一个严肃的发髻。
- Her face was framed by a severe bun, making her look older than her years.她的脸被一个紧绷的发髻框住,让她看起来比实际年龄要大。
- For the formal gala, she opted for a sleek dress and a severe bun.为了参加正式的晚会,她选择了一件时髦的连衣裙和一个利落的发髻。
- The ballerina's hair was pulled back into a severe bun to keep it out of her face.芭蕾舞演员的头发被盘成一个紧实的发髻,以免挡住她的脸。
- He remembered his grandmother as a stern woman with a perpetually severe bun.他记忆中的祖母是一位总是梳着严肃发髻的严厉女人。
- The headmistress's severe bun seemed to tighten every time a student misbehaved.每当有学生行为不端时,女校长的严肃发髻似乎都会收得更紧。
- To look more professional for the interview, she slicked her hair back into a severe bun.为了在面试中显得更专业,她把头发向后梳成一个利落的发髻。
- The portrait depicted a noblewoman with piercing eyes and a perfectly coiffed severe bun.这幅肖像画描绘了一位贵妇,她有着锐利的眼神和梳理得一丝不苟的严肃发髻。
- Even in the heat, not a single strand of hair escaped from her severe bun.即使在炎热的天气里,也没有一根头发从她那紧绷的发髻中散落下来。
- She loosened her severe bun at the end of the long day, sighing with relief.在漫长的一天结束后,她松开了她紧绷的发髻,如释重负地叹了口气。
